Outdoor charging pile
By adopting a linked shell structure and hollow layer design in the charging pile, the problem of easy damage to the charging pile shell is solved, and the effect of structural stability and convenient maintenance is achieved.

AI Technical Summary
The existing charging pile casing has low structural strength and is easily damaged by outdoor impacts, affecting the safety and stability of the circuit module.
The system adopts a linkage structure between the first and second shells, connected by bending components, and incorporates hollow layers in each component to enhance structural strength. It also features locking components and locking rods for convenient maintenance.
This improves the structural stability and safety of outdoor charging stations, while also facilitating rapid maintenance of circuit modules.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of charging pile technology, and specifically relates to an outdoor charging pile. Background Technology
[0002] Charging stations are devices that provide electricity to electric vehicles and are an important part of the new energy vehicle ecosystem. Many existing charging stations have relatively simple shell structures with low strength, making them susceptible to impacts outdoors, which can damage the internal circuit modules.
[0003] Therefore, further improvements will be made to address the aforementioned issues. Utility Model Content
[0004] The main purpose of this utility model is to provide an outdoor charging pile, which is linked by a first shell and a second shell, and the various components are stably connected by a bending member. Furthermore, the structural strength is improved by a hollow layer. It has the advantages of structural stability, convenient maintenance, and high safety.
[0005]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ides an outdoor charging pile, including a housing module and a circuit module. The circuit module is built into the housing module. The housing module includes a first housing and a second housing. The first housing is located at the front of the second housing, and the top of the first housing is hinged to the top of the second housing.
[0006] The first housing includes a first top, a first bottom, a first side, a second side, a first bending member, a second bending member, a third bending member, a fourth bending member, and a panel. The first bending member is fixedly installed between the first side and the first top, and the second bending member is fixedly installed between the first top and the second side. The third bending member is fixedly installed between the second side and the first bottom, and the fourth bending member is fixedly installed between the first bottom and the first side.
[0007] The second housing includes a second top, a second bottom, a third side, a fourth side, a fifth bending member, a sixth bending member, a seventh bending member, an eighth bending member, and a bottom plate. The fifth bending member is fixedly installed between the third side and the second top, and the sixth bending member is fixedly installed between the second top and the fourth side. The seventh bending member is fixedly installed between the fourth side and the second bottom, and the eighth bending member is fixedly installed between the second bottom and the third side.
[0008] The first top, the first bottom, the first side, the second side, the second top, the second bottom, the third side, and the fourth side are all provided with hollow layers (to improve the resistance to impact and enhance structural stability).
[0009] As a further pre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, the first top, the first bottom, the first side, the second side, the second top, the second bottom, the third side, and the fourth side are all provided with slots, which are used to install corresponding bent parts (to limit the installation of bent parts and improve structural stability).
[0010] As a further preferred technical solution of the above technical solution, the first bottom is provided with a locking element (locking hook) and the second bottom is provided with a locking rod (when the first housing and the second housing are fixed, they are stabilized by the locking element and the locking rod. When it is necessary to inspect and maintain the circuit module therein, the locking element and the locking rod can be opened, and then the first housing can be lifted relative to the second housing, which is quick and convenient).
[0011] As a further pre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, the panel is fixedly connected to the first top, the first bottom, the first side and the second side respectively, and the base plate is fixedly connected to the second top, the second bottom, the third side and the fourth side respectively, and the base plate is used to place the circuit module.
[0012] As a further pre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, the third side is provided with a charging gun connection end. Attached Figure Description

[0019] This utility model discloses an outdoor charging pile. The specific embodiments of the utility model will be further described below with reference to preferred embodiments.
[0020] In the embodiments of this utility model, those skilled in the art will note that the circuit modules and the like involved in this utility model can be considered as prior art.
[0021] Preferred embodiment.
[0022] like Figure 1-4 As shown, this utility model discloses an outdoor charging pile, including a shell module and a circuit module. The circuit module is built into the shell module. The shell module includes a first shell 10 and a second shell 20. The first shell 10 is located at the front of the second shell 20, and the top of the first shell 10 is hinged to the top of the second shell 20.
[0023] The first housing 10 includes a first top 11, a first bottom 12, a first side 13, a second side 14, a first bending member 15, a second bending member 16, a third bending member 17, a fourth bending member 18, and a panel 19. The first bending member 15 is fixedly installed between the first side 13 and the first top 12, and the second bending member 16 is fixedly installed between the first top 12 and the second side 14. The third bending member 17 is fixedly installed between the second side 14 and the first bottom 12, and the fourth bending member 18 is fixedly installed between the first bottom 12 and the first side 13.
[0024] The second housing 20 includes a second top 21, a second bottom 22, a third side 23, a fourth side 24, a fifth bending member 25, a sixth bending member 26, a seventh bending member 27, an eighth bending member 28, and a bottom plate 29. The fifth bending member 25 is fixedly installed between the third side 23 and the second top 21, and the sixth bending member 26 is fixedly installed between the second top 21 and the fourth side 24. The seventh bending member 27 is fixedly installed between the fourth side 24 and the second bottom 22, and the eighth bending member 28 is fixedly installed between the second bottom 22 and the third side 23.
[0025] The first top 11, the first bottom 12, the first side 13, the second side 14, the second top 21, the second bottom 22, the third side 23 and the fourth side 24 are all provided with a hollow layer 191 (to improve the pressure resistance under impact and improve the structural stability).
[0026] Specifically, the first top 11, the first bottom 12, the first side 13, the second side 14, the second top 21, the second bottom 22, the third side 23, and the fourth side 24 are all provided with slots, which are used to install corresponding bent parts (to limit the installation of bent parts and improve structural stability).
[0027] More specifically, the first bottom 12 is provided with a locking piece 192 (locking hook) and the second bottom 22 is provided with a locking rod 291 (when the first housing and the second housing are fixed, they are secured by the locking piece and the locking rod. When it is necessary to inspect and maintain the circuit module therein, the locking piece and the locking rod can be opened, and then the first housing can be lifted relative to the second housing, which is quick and convenient).
[0028] Furthermore, the panel 19 is fixedly connected to the first top 11, the first bottom 12, the first side 13 and the second side 14 respectively, and the base plate 29 is fixedly connected to the second top 21, the second bottom 22, the third side 23 and the fourth side 24 respectively. The base plate 29 is used to place the circuit module 30.
[0029] Furthermore, the third side portion 23 is provided with a charging gun connection end 292.
